There are some differences and I'll cover a few of them "Generically"

Analog Pass Through.. The models marked with a * have it, some others might, this feature allows your television to receive analog. May or may not be important to you. Others here have reported the analog pass through is not that good (looses a lot of signal strength) I have a work around I've designed, very simple, at most it takes 2 parts and 2 cables that are not in the box Here is the verbal description

Put a splitter before the converter, one line to the converter the other to a common A/B switch (The "A" terminal) output from the converter to the "B" (or Game Or cable or whatever they call it) terminal, remaining terminal to tv.

(Option Forget the switch, run the line off the splitter direct to the tv and use A/V cable from the converter's A/V out to the tv's A/V in if any. I use that method here at home)

OPTIONS: Some converters have different menu options. For example my Insignia, which I'm told is identical to the Zenith, has the option of STEREO/MONO audio out, turns out this makes a big difference on my mono-TV. (Won't in the MH which has all stereo TV's) My ACCESS does not have that option. Signal meters (mentioned above) Insignia has it, thus Zenith has it, don't recall if Access has it. But these are useful too.

Programming guide.. The Insignia has a 2 program guide (Current and next) the Access displays more into the future. However there are other advantages to the Insignia display

Suggestion.. Try to find a store that has one hooked up so you can watch it.
